Full Job Description
📋 Description
- • As a Senior PCI Analyst at Computer Systems, Inc., you will play a critical role in safeguarding payment card data by ensuring organizational compliance with PCI DSS standards, directly supporting the security posture of financial institutions served by CSI.
- • Day to day, you will conduct PCI DSS compliance assessments, develop and maintain security policies, validate compliance across systems, define scope boundaries, collaborate with cross-functional teams, document findings, and serve as an internal consultant for PCI-related matters.
- • You will join the Enterprise Information Security Services department at CSI, a forward-thinking software provider with a 60-year legacy of empowering community and regional financial institutions through innovative, secure technologies in banking, payments, and cybersecurity.
- • In this role, you will deepen your expertise in PCI DSS 4.0.1, NIST, and ISO 27001 frameworks, lead complex compliance initiatives, and contribute to reducing risk while enabling secure payment processing at scale.
🎯 Requirements
- • Minimum of 5 years of experience in a PCI DSS compliance role
- • At least one relevant certification (e.g., PCIP, QSA, CISSP, ISA)
- • Excellent understanding of PCI DSS requirements and security frameworks (e.g., PCI DSS 4.0.1, NIST Cybersecurity Framework, ISO 27001)
- • Strong knowledge of network security, encryption, and secure system configurations
- • Demonstrated proficiency using compliance management platforms (e.g., Archer, Qualys, ServiceNow)
